Four Seasons Celebrates Four Top-Ranked Bars on Asia's 50 Best Bars 2025


ARGO (Hong Kong), VIRTÙ (Tokyo), BKK Social Club (Bangkok), and Bar Trigona (Kuala Lumpur) earn top honours on the prestigious Asia’s 50 Best Bars list


Four Seasons continues to be recognized for its exceptional bar concepts, with four bars featured on the esteemed Asia’s 50 Best Bars list. At the ceremony held in Macau on July 15, 2025, Asia’s Best Bars Academy announced impressive results for four Four Seasons bars: ARGO at #11, VIRTÙ at #18, BKK Social Club at #19 and Bar Trigona at #39. They are joined by Charles H., who also made it into the top 100, securing the #96 spot.


“This recognition is a powerful reflection of the creativity, craftsmanship, and pursuit of excellence shown by our extraordinary bar teams,” says Philipp Blaser, Senior Vice President of Food and Beverage, Four Seasons. “Having multiple Four Seasons bars ranked among the best in such a competitive region is a testament to the passion of our people and their dedication to quality, innovation, and delivering exceptional guest experiences that set new standards in the industry.”


This latest achievement builds on the success of Four Seasons showing on the World’s 50 Best Bars list announced in October 2024, where BKK Social Club ranked number #12, VIRTÙ placed at #42, and ARGO was listed among the top 100 at #58.  These accolades highlight the exceptional quality of the Four Seasons bar portfolio, each combining local character with inventive cocktail craftsmanship.


#11 Best Bar in Asia: ARGO, Hong Kong

Set against sweeping views of Victoria Harbour, ARGO at Four Seasons Hotel Hong Kong invites guests to discover inventive cocktails crafted with unexpected ingredients and a sense of exploration. Led by Bar Manager Federico Balzarini, whose international expertise brings a refined touch of dolce vita to the experience, ARGO continues to push boundaries in contemporary mixology. The hotel is also home to four acclaimed dining venues collectively holding eight Michelin stars, making it a premier destination for culinary and cocktail excellence.


#18 Best Bar in Asia: VIRTÙ, Tokyo

Perched on the 39th floor of Four Seasons Hotel Tokyo at Otemachi, VIRTÙ offers a striking combination of French sophistication and Japanese precision. Led by award-winning Head Bartender Keith Motsi, the bar showcases an exceptional collection of vintage French spirits, rare cognacs, and standout Japanese labels. With sweeping views of the Tokyo skyline, VIRTÙ delivers an elevated cocktail experience rooted in craft and culture.


#19 Best Bar in Asia: BKK Social Club, Bangkok

Located within Four Seasons Hotel Bangkok at Chao Phraya River, BKK Social Club draws inspiration from the vibrant spirit of Latin America, blending the glamour of Mexico City with the dynamic energy of modern Bangkok. Under the direction of Beverage Manager Philip Bischoff, the bar features a menu of bespoke cocktails and curated craft spirits, set within a sophisticated setting and accompanied by a lively, contemporary soundtrack.


#39 Best Bar in Asia: Bar Trigona, Kuala Lumpur

Located within Four Seasons Hotel Kuala Lumpur, Bar Trigona is deeply rooted in sustainability and local storytelling. Under the direction of Head Bartender Rohan Matmary, the team champions Malaysian ingredients through a menu inspired by garden botanicals, spice boxes, tea rituals, and the native trigona honeybee. This namesake pollinator remains central to the bar’s ongoing conservation efforts, inviting guests to take part in preserving local ecosystems while enjoying a distinctly Malaysian cocktail experience.

Four Seasons Showcases Global Bar Talent at Tales of the Cocktail

Mixologists from across the Four Seasons portfolio are gathering in New Orleans for a week of events celebrating the craft, creativity, and culture of modern bartending


Celebrated for its exceptional hospitality and acclaimed bars, Four Seasons will take part in Tales of the Cocktail, the world’s leading cocktail and spirits conference, held in New Orleans from July 21 to 25, 2025. Throughout the week, mixologists from Four Seasons properties around the world will participate in a series of immersive events, showcasing the brand’s signature craftsmanship, innovation, and commitment to beverage excellence in one of the world’s most spirited cities.


“Tales of the Cocktail is the perfect platform for Four Seasons to highlight the talent, creativity, and passion that define our bars,” says Philipp Blaser, Senior Vice President of Food and Beverage, Four Seasons. “This is an opportunity to celebrate the artistry of our craftspeople and deepen our connection to the international bar community. We are proud to bring some of our most acclaimed bar experiences to a city so deeply rooted in cocktail culture.”


As part of the week’s programming, the 19th annual Spirited Awards will take place on Thursday, July 24, recognizing excellence within the industry both in the United States and internationally. This year, four Four Seasons bars have been named as finalists: ARGO (Hong Kong), Charles H. (Seoul), and VIRTÙ (Tokyo) for Best International Hotel Bar, and Champagne Bar (Miami Beach) for Best U.S. Hotel Bar. These categories honour bars that exemplify the highest standards of service, cocktail execution, and the timeless appeal of the hotel bar tradition.

New Orleans: A Global Stage for Cocktail Culture

Rooted in tradition and driven by innovation, New Orleans sets the scene for Tales of the Cocktail 2025. With its storied cocktail legacy and unmistakable charm, New Orleans stands as one of the world’s great cocktail capitals. Widely recognized as the birthplace of iconic drinks such as the Sazerac and the Ramos Gin Fizz, the city continues to inspire with its dynamic mix of heritage, creativity, and vibrant hospitality.


At the heart of the celebration is Four Seasons Hotel New Orleans, an architectural landmark ideally positioned on Canal Street at the edge of the French Quarter. With sweeping views of the Mississippi River and a setting that echoes the spirit of the city, the hotel will serve as a central gathering point during the week’s events. Reflecting the rhythm and richness of New Orleans, the property is also home to two standout dining destinations: Miss River, where Southern cuisine is reimagined with bold creativity, and Chemin à la Mer, a refined steakhouse and oyster bar, both led by local James Beard Award-winning chef partners. Together, they offer guests an immersive taste of New Orleans through the lens of Four Seasons.


VIRTÙ at Four Seasons Hotel Tokyo at Otemachi Grabs #18 Spot on Asia’s 50 Best Bars List 2025

The destination bar features on the coveted list for the third consecutive year

VIRTÙ, the acclaimed bar at Four Seasons Hotel Tokyo at Otemachi, has secured the #18 spot on Asia’s 50 Best Bars list for 2025. Unveiled at a glittering ceremony in Macao on July 15, the accolade solidifies VIRTÙ’s status as a premier destination for cocktail enthusiasts in the region, highlighting its exceptional blend of innovative mixology and warm hospitality. In addition, the bar is currently ranked #42 among the World’s 50 Best Bars and won the Michter’s Art of Hospitality Award as part of Asia’s 50 Best Bars 2024.


“We’re thrilled to be recognised as one of the leading bars in Asia for the third year running,” shares Head Bartender Keith Motsi. “This award fuels our enthusiasm for pushing the boundaries of what’s possible in a cocktail glass and crafting moments that endure long after the night is over. We’re immensely grateful for the continuing love and support of our community in Asia and beyond. None of this would be possible without all of you.”


With its air of laidback glamour, steeped in art deco and storytelling, VIRTÙ has carved out a distinct place in Tokyo’s much-lauded bar scene. Here, high above the streets of Otemachi, the elegance of Paris encounters the craftsmanship of Tokyo, unveiling a beverage menu filled with cross-cultural discoveries.


Drawing from a world-leading collection of vintage French spirits and rare cognacs, Keith and his team reinterpret classic French flavours through modern Japanese techniques, inviting guests into a drinking experience that feels familiar yet fresh. Stories are at the forefront of every sipping journey, from Japanese tales to European fables, offering unexpected ways to connect with VIRTÙ’s core inspirations.


Four Seasons bars across the region were also honoured in the 2025 list, underscoring the brand’s leadership in beverage innovation and the art of hospitality. From Bar Trigona at Four Seasons Hotel Kuala Lumpur (#39) to BKK Social Club at Four Seasons Hotel Bangkok at Chao Phraya River (#19), and ARGO at Four Seasons Hotel Hong Kong (#11), each destination reflects a bold point of view and a deep connection to place.
